Long before girls were allowed to play Little League, Kathryn “Tubby” Johnston loved baseball so much she disguised herself as a boy, lied about her name and played her way onto a Little League team in 1950s America. What started as the pursuit of a childhood dream became a symbolic act of rebellion that helped crack open the sport for generations of girls to come.
